Product Information

1-Amino-4-bromoanthraquinone is a versatile chemical compound widely recognized for its applications in the dye and pigment industries. This compound, characterized by its vibrant color properties, is primarily utilized as a dye intermediate, particularly in the production of high-performance pigments. Its unique structure allows for excellent lightfastness and stability, making it an ideal choice for applications in textiles, plastics, and coatings. Additionally, 1-Amino-4-bromoanthraquinone serves as a key component in the synthesis of various organic compounds, enhancing its relevance in research and development settings.

In the field of analytical chemistry, this compound is also employed as a reagent for the detection of specific metal ions, showcasing its utility beyond just dye production. Researchers appreciate its ability to facilitate complex reactions while maintaining a high degree of specificity. Applications

1-Amino-4-bromoanthraquinone is widely utilized in research focused on:

  • Dyes and Pigments: This compound is used in the production of high-performance dyes, particularly in textiles and printing, due to its vibrant color and stability.
  • Photovoltaic Applications: It serves as a key material in organic solar cells, enhancing light absorption and energy conversion efficiency, making it valuable for renewable energy solutions.
  • Fluorescent Probes: In biochemical research, it acts as a fluorescent probe for detecting specific biomolecules, aiding in diagnostics and cellular imaging.
  • Antimicrobial Agents: The compound exhibits antimicrobial properties, making it useful in developing coatings and treatments for medical devices to prevent infections.
  • Research in Organic Electronics: It is explored in the field of organic electronics for its potential in developing efficient electronic components, such as transistors and light-emitting diodes (LEDs).
